I was drawn to "In Italy for Love" by Leonie Mack for its promise of a romantic Italian getaway. While the book certainly delivered on the picturesque setting, I found myself wishing for a bit more depth in the story and characters.

The Italian backdrop was absolutely enchanting, and Mack's descriptions brought the sights and sounds to life. However, the plot felt a bit predictable, and the characters lacked the complexity I craved. While Lou and Nick were likable enough, their connection didn't spark the same passion I had hoped for.

Despite these minor shortcomings, "In Italy for Love" is a charming read that offers a glimpse into the beauty of Italy. If you're looking for a lighthearted romance with a touch of Italian flair, this book might be just what you're seeking.

Julia is stuck in Italy, with an expired passport, a rundown B&B, and still living with her ex, Luca. Rather than ask her parents for help, she decides to help herself - and heads in the opposite direction of Luca, to work on an olive farm, hopefully earning enough money to pay for her passport to be renewed and a flight ticket back home. The farm that she winds up on is beautiful, and the locals very welcoming to her. Julia intends to not get romantically involved with anyone, but then she meets Alex who also has made the same promise to himself. Alex is also in a rut, but then things start to feel differently for him once he meets Julia.

This was a great story for romance, yes, but also really good character growth, especially for Alex, I felt. He had been through a lot, which actually made him very relatable, and he learned to overcome. Julia, also, was relatable in that she was able to problem solve and learned to come out on the other side of things.

In Italy for love by Leonie Mack will be released Oct 22th and it follows Julia Volpe who flees the remnants of her failed Italian dream to work on an olive farm in the quaint town of Cividale del Friuli. Still living with her ex and struggling to move on, Jules is determined to rebuild her life—but she hadn’t counted on the beauty of Italy or the warmth of the locals to break down her walls. When she meets the enigmatic Alex, a man with his own reasons to avoid love, Jules’ resolve to stay single begins to waver. I liked how Italy was described in this, so so lovely! It's a journey of self discovery and healing for the FMC which I really liked to read about!

Jules is from Australia but a few years ago she followed her heart and moved to Italy. Well, that was a huge mistake. She is now broken up with him but has still been living with him for a year. She has to go. She can’t stand another minute there. So, she packs everything she can up, and off she goes..her dog following her. With her bank account low, she has few options. Even fewer with a dog. She’s in luck, a farm across Italy has a job available for housing. Perfect. Onward she goes. Once arrived, she meets Alex. He’s playing the accordion outside and she’s intrigued. Maybe this move won’t be so bad.

Alex has had a very difficult past few years. Life has not gone his way and now his life is just a monotonous loop. His family is worried, as he never smiles. Alex doesn’t know how to move forward. As he’s playing one evening, Jules approaches…and he smiles.

Such a beautiful story. Your heart goes out to Alex and you instantly want the best for him. Definitely a story of growth, family, and love.
